About Dr. Bachman Dr. Kathryn S. Bachman has always loved science and cared about helping others. But she didn’t discover her passion for medicine until her junior year of college while studying abroad in Peru. “I spent part of the term with a physician and his family, and I fell in love with the art and science of medicine.” Dr. Bachman uses her passion for helping others in family practice. There, she goes beyond medicine with her empathy and forms deeper connections with her patients to work together to treat a wide variety of acute and chronic conditions. “I love family medicine because of the chance to build long-term relationships with patients, their families and the community. I believe high quality and empathetic primary care – and family medicine in particular – is the best way to provide health care.” Dr. Bachman earned her medical degree at Des Moines University. She completed her Family Medicine Residency at the Community Health Network in Indianapolis. But the greatest lesson came from her patients. “Humans are resilient,” she says. “I’m constantly amazed at the obstacles people overcome, and I feel very privileged to sit with and stand witness to the moments of both difficulty and triumph.” This respect for human resilience and well-being shapes Dr. Bachman’s practice philosophy – and inspired her to join Beacon. “I think that medicine should be not-for-profit and that health care systems should serve the community that they are in,” says Dr. Bachman. “I want to work with people who are committed to serving patients and the community, and I felt that when I met with Beacon providers.” In Her Own Words Who is or was the most influential person/role model in your life?
